What Makes Stoneware So Durable?

Stoneware earns respect largely because of its strength. Clay used for stoneware gets fired at high temperatures inside a kiln. That heat transforms soft clay into dense ceramic capable of handling daily use.

Dinner plates created through that process handle heat, cold, and repeated washing without complaint. A busy dinner table might include pasta, roasted vegetables, grilled meat, or fresh bread served directly on the plate. Stoneware handles each dish easily.

Many hosts also appreciate another practical detail. Plates that retain warmth help food stay pleasant during longer meals. No one enjoys a cold dinner halfway through a lively conversation.

Durability means hosts spend less time worrying about dishes and more time enjoying the evening.
